“Every person deserves compassion, dignity, and the safety of a place to call home.”

Homelessness is the largest social and public health crisis in California. Illumination Foundation (IF) is a growing non-profit organization dedicated towards disrupting the cycle of homelessness by providing targeted, interdisciplinary services in our recuperative care centers, emergency shelters, housing services and children's and family programs. IF currently has 13+ facilities with 22+ micro-communities scattered across Orange County, Los Angeles County and the Inland Empire.

Job Description

The Children and Families Lead Care Manager is responsible for coordinating the care of children and families that are residing in Illumination Foundation’s family emergency shelters. LCMs will conduct Comprehensive Health Assessments, complete developmental screenings, and provide referrals and linkages to resources. LCMs will provide follow-up support in the form of Care Plan to families after leaving the program to ensure children participate in ongoing services.

The pay range for this position is $23.00 - $26.00 per hour, depending on experience.

Responsibilities

Administrative/ Record Keeping
  • Maintain updated & accurate case notes within 24 – 48 hours of services provided, records, & relevant paperwork on Illumination Foundation’s internal EHR system: AICA & HMIS
  • Provide a minimum of 2 hours of services every 25 days to a caseload of 30 clients.
  • Complete ECM Enrollment protocols to track client’s consent to enroll in the program.
  • Input and enter all data from screenings (ASQ, ASQ-SE, SDQ, PEARLS etc.) on relevant documents, AICA, and HMIS. 
  • Utilize the Children’s Registry for entry of Developmental Screenings data and referrals. 
  • Diligently Track program services in the form of an on-going Care Plan, for purposes of data collection, and proof of desired outcomes.
  • Maintain a weekly log and update case files/notes as necessary.
  • Collaborate with other departments at Illumination Foundation as necessary.
  • Complete referral paperwork as deemed appropriate for children and families.
  • Collaborate with external partner agencies and organizations.
Direct Services
  • Complete a Health Risk Assessment (HRA) after enrollment into ECM.
  • Conduct developmental screenings for all children who enter ECM (ASQ, ASQ-SE, SDQ, PEARLS etc.).
  • Create a Care Plan based on the health & social needs found during the HRA.
  • Attend scheduled appointments, as deemed necessary, and advocate for clients at scheduled appointments relating to client’s housing, health, education, and social and emotional wellbeing.
  • Regularly meet with Clinical Consultant to review client health/medical needs to provide advocacy, health and preventative care education
  • Educate parents on topics around parenting, child development and available services.
  • Address familial concerns as they arise with parents.
  • Provide transportation for client appointments if deemed necessary.
  • Provide referrals and track linkages to relevant services for children on caseload.
  • Attend team meetings, case conferences and supervision as scheduled.
  • Collaborate with the Children's Department to provide children’s services to families staying in IF emergency and bridge housing facilities.
  • Continually update resources for activities and lesson plans.
  • Monitor for signs of emotional or developmental troubles in children and communicate to the supervisor.
  • As a mandated reporter, monitor for signs of emotional, physical, and sexual abuse and communicate to CPS as deemed necessary by law.
